Index processing using transformed values

Data processing: database and file management or data structures – Database design – Data structure types

Reexamination Certificate

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

C707S793000, C707S793000, C711S216000

Reexamination Certificate

active

07627609

ABSTRACT:
A method, article of manufacture, and apparatus for tracking a plurality of objects being stored are disclosed. In an embodiment, this comprises computing the hash value of the name of each object being stored, transforming the hash value into a plurality of bytes such that none of the bytes has the value of a flag used by the system, concatenating the transformed hashed values into a hint, and storing the hint in an index. In an embodiment, bytes having the flag value are mapped to an unused value during the transformation. In an embodiment, the hint is retrieved from the index and hashed values are transformed back. Mapped values are restored to the flag values. This allows use of the hint with a system that uses a flag in the index as an indicator; for example, to indicate that an endpoint has been reached.

REFERENCES:
patent: 4358825 (1982-11-01), Kyu et al.
patent: 5040179 (1991-08-01), Chen
patent: 5768526 (1998-06-01), Fawcett
patent: 5887159 (1999-03-01), Burrows
patent: 5893087 (1999-04-01), Wlaschin et al.
patent: 5909695 (1999-06-01), Wong et al.
patent: 5978791 (1999-11-01), Farber et al.
patent: 6128623 (2000-10-01), Mattis et al.
patent: 6189046 (2001-02-01), Moore et al.
patent: 6223343 (2001-04-01), Hopwood et al.
patent: 6249782 (2001-06-01), Day et al.
patent: 6260044 (2001-07-01), Nagral et al.
patent: 6278992 (2001-08-01), Curtis et al.
patent: 6289358 (2001-09-01), Mattis et al.
patent: 6292880 (2001-09-01), Mattis et al.
patent: 6453319 (2002-09-01), Maltis et al.
patent: 6457029 (2002-09-01), Switzer, Jr.
patent: 6529146 (2003-03-01), Kowalski et al.
patent: 6611609 (2003-08-01), Zhu
patent: 6611850 (2003-08-01), Shen
patent: 6633892 (2003-10-01), Chan et al.
patent: 6778979 (2004-08-01), Grefenstette et al.
patent: 6820075 (2004-11-01), Shanahan et al.
patent: 6895507 (2005-05-01), Teppler
patent: 6928425 (2005-08-01), Grefenstette et al.
patent: 6985901 (2006-01-01), Sachse et al.
patent: 7085271 (2006-08-01), Gooch
patent: 7130445 (2006-10-01), Ruhl et al.
patent: 7159070 (2007-01-01), Kilian et al.
patent: 7181731 (2007-02-01), Pace et al.
patent: 7280055 (2007-10-01), Drasny
patent: 2001/0002485 (2001-05-01), Bisbee et al.
patent: 2002/0052884 (2002-05-01), Farber et al.
patent: 2002/0087588 (2002-07-01), McBride et al.
patent: 2002/0120639 (2002-08-01), Basin et al.
patent: 2002/0184244 (2002-12-01), Hsiao et al.
patent: 2003/0005103 (2003-01-01), Narad et al.
patent: 2003/0046260 (2003-03-01), Satyanarayanan et al.
patent: 2003/0051236 (2003-03-01), Pace et al.
patent: 2003/0195904 (2003-10-01), Chestnut et al.
patent: 2003/0208493 (2003-11-01), Hall et al.
patent: 2003/0233401 (2003-12-01), Dean
patent: 2004/0098383 (2004-05-01), Tabellion et al.
patent: 2004/0139098 (2004-07-01), Margolus et al.
patent: 2004/0199516 (2004-10-01), Thames et al.
patent: 2005/0004993 (2005-01-01), Miller et al.
patent: 2005/0086241 (2005-04-01), Ram et al.
patent: 2005/0125627 (2005-06-01), Kilian et al.
patent: 2005/0257062 (2005-11-01), Ignatius et al.
patent: 2006/0184556 (2006-08-01), Tan et al.
patent: 2006/0236074 (2006-10-01), Williamson et al.
patent: 2007/0052563 (2007-03-01), Drasny
patent: 2007/0185914 (2007-08-01), Prahlad et al.
patent: 2008/0114839 (2008-05-01), Borgendale
G. H. Gonnet, R. Baeza-Yates, Handbook of Algorithms and Data Structures, 1991, 2ndedition, pp. 47-48, Addison-Wesley Pub. Co., Wokingham, England and Readking, Mass.
M.T. Goodrich, R. Tamassia, Data Structures and Algorithms in Java, 1997, pp. 118-119, Wiley Pub. Co., New York.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Index processing using transformed values does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Index processing using transformed values,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Index processing using transformed values will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-4089979

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.